Plot

In the frost-bitten heart of Europe, society staggers forward, bearing the scar of the horrifying Charlie Hebdo terrorist assault. Treading this fragmented landscape, Omar, a freshly emancipated convict, stealthily navigates his own plans. Unseen threads of fate link him with Finn, a passionate filmmaker, Dan, a vigilant Jewish watchman, and Rico, a battle-weary special forces officer. Each man, immersed in his own daily struggle, remains blind to their interconnected fate. In a world that shifts under their feet like quicksand, they grapple to understand their individual realities. It is only when the harsh tide of change sweeps over them, swift and pitiless, that they grasp the fragility of life. Tragically, only one voice survives to recount the devastating attack that indelibly scars their nation's identity. This is a chilling tale of lives intertwined by destiny, forever marked by a day that echoes with the haunting refrain, "The Day We Died."

The Day We Died is a drama movie featuring Nikolaj Coster-Waldau and directed by Ole Christian Madsen.
